So my PSU started pumping out some really nasty smelling burning stench today. Poor guy made it 7 years with me. Now I need some suggestions for wattage and model for a new one.

CPU: i5-4770k (not much overclocking, but the potential to would be nice)
GPU: GTX 780 ti

I've read that 500 is fine for it, but then someone comes in an argues that no, 600 is what it will need. Then someone else comes in and says no, 650...blahblah you know how it goes.

Any help is much appreciated!

nvidia's exact words
"600 watt or greater power supply with a minimum of 42 amps on the +12 volt rail."

the ampere rating is more important than the watt rating. you can have a shitty "800 watt" PSU that will blow up if it tried to power a GTX 780 Ti because the 12V simply cannot handle the load. at the same time, a super high quality 550 watt platinum rated PSU can power a GTX 780 Ti without a problem.

so, in reality the answer is not so simple. if you are buying a regular "bronze rated" PSU, go for 600 or better.
